
4
Interfaces
Page 17 / 39
IMAGO Technologies GmbH
Strassheimer Str. 45; 61169 Friedberg; Germany; Tel. +49(0)6031-6842611
LED Flash Controller
The LED Flash Controller is designed as a current source. Output current, flash duration and other parame-
ters can be set via software.
The following diagram shows the simplified internal structure for the LED Controller:
CPU
Real-Time
Communication
Controller
(FPGA)
Output Channel
Filter
Current
Regulation
Ext. LED
Lighting
Unit
+24V
Current
reference
Strobe
enable
Current
value
LED +
R
Sense
LED -
GND
Power
Supply
VisionCam
Int. LED
ring-light
Figure 3:
LED Controller structure
The software API allows selection between the internal ring-light (optional) and the external connector.
See chapter 4.1 for connector pinout.
When initializing the strobe controller using the API, the user has to specify a load voltage for the given
current value (see
SetLimits()
and
SetFixedCurrent()
). This information is used to protect the
internal circuit against overload by increasing the minimum OFF-time or by limiting the current value. If
there load voltage is not exactly known, lower values should be used because this provides more
protection.
With the internal ring-light, the following load voltages should be used:
Current (mA)
Load voltage (V)
100…499
8
500…999
10
1000
…1499
12
1500…1999
15
2000
17